Kerala Softens Traffic Rule: Driving Licence to Be Cancelled Only After 10 Violations

Thiruvananthapuram: In a major relief for motorists, the Kerala government is set to revise the strict provisions of the Central Motor Vehicles Act, deciding to cancel driving licences only after 10 or more traffic violations, instead of the earlier proposal of five. Kerala SSLC Exams to Start on March 5; Results Scheduled for May 8

Thiruvananthapuram: The Kerala SSLC (Class 10) public examinations will begin on March 5, with the results to be announced on May 8, State Education Minister V. Sivankutty has confirmed. Kerala Declares Tidal Sea Erosion a State-Specific Disaster

Thiruvananthapuram: In a major relief measure for coastal communities, the Kerala government has officially declared sea incursions occurring during high tide and low tide as a state-specific disaster. Kerala High Court Permits Termination of Over 31-Week-Old Foetus With Severe Abnormalities

Kochi: The Kerala High Court has permitted the termination of a foetus over 31 weeks old after medical reports confirmed serious congenital abnormalities, observing that forcing the continuation of such a pregnancy would cause undue physical and mental trauma to the woman.
